"Jonge vrouw bij een bron" (Young Woman at a Spring) is an engraving by Richard Houston, a British artist, created in 1756. The artwork depicts a young woman standing in a garden setting, holding a bowl as water flows into it from a fountain. The scene is likely allegorical, representing the beauty and purity of water. The engraving is a fine example of 18th-century printmaking, characterized by its delicate lines and detailed rendering. It is currently housed in the Rijksmuseum in Amsterdam, Netherlands.
